paramagnetism
a material being weakly attracted to an external magnetic field due to unpaired electrons (looking for pairs)
ferromagnetism
when all the electron spins point the same way a material becomes strongly magnetic and a permanent magnet
diamagnetism
all electrons are paired so a material is weakly repelled
domain
a region in a ferromagnetic material where all spins point the same direction
pauli exclusion principle
no 2 electrons in the same orbital will have the same spin
